If h(x) = (f o g)(x) and h(x) = sqrt(x+5), find g(x) if f(x) = sqrt(x+2)
agasfer [191]

Answer:

  • g(x) = x + 3

Step-by-step explanation:

<h3>Given</h3>
  • h(x) = (f ο g)(x)
  • h(x) = \sqrt{x+5}
  • f(x) = \sqrt{x+2}
<h3>To find</h3>
  • g(x)
<h3>Solution</h3>

<u>We know that:</u>

  • (f ο g)(x) = f(g(x))

<u>Substitute x with g(x) and solve for g(x):</u>

  • \sqrt{x+5} = \sqrt{g(x)+2}
  • x + 5 = g(x) + 2
  • x + 3 = g(x)
  • g(x) = x + 3
